Manatee County Sheriff's Office, Florida
End of Watch Monday, November 24, 1986
Add to My HeroesHerbert W. Grimes
Detective Herbert Grimes succumbed to injuries sustained on November 20th, 1986, when his unmarked vehicle was struck by a tow truck at the intersection of U.S. 41 and 26th Avenue.
He was transported to Manatee Memorial Hospital where he remained until succumbing to his injuries on November 24th, 1986.
Detective Grimes had served with the Manatee County Sheriff's Office for 5-1/2 years. He was survived by his wife and two young sons.
